My gynaecology appointment was just after 7pm at night in winter and I got lost finding the clinic building in the dark as it was separate from the main Hospital and there were no signs for it on the road I came into the campus.

Having rushed to get there, the staff immediately made me feel relaxed and calm. They all introduced themselves in a warm and friendly manner. I was also anxious about the procedure I was going to have, but the gynaecologist, Dr Blair, explained all about it and reassured me. When I mentioned I was well overdue a smear test she said she could also do that at the same time, to save me having another speculum examination at a later date at my GP surgery. 

Dr Blair carried out the procedures very professionally and in such a way as to keep any discomfort to a minimum, while Nikki the nurse, kept me relaxed throughout by talking about various things that acted as a distraction.... and it worked!  

The appointment kept to time which was amazing considering this was so late in the day - I had expected the clinic to be running late at such an hour. Afterwards Nikki escorted me to the entrance and ensured I knew where the car park was.

The whole experience was very impressive from start to finish. The staff could not have been better and I am so appreciative of the service that they are offering, especially running these extra clinics to catch up with the backlog. I would like to express my heartfelt thanks to such a professional team and to NHS staff as a whole for the excellent work they do.
